- W4211246675 abstract "Early British medical libraries owned by practitioners of medicine are not easily distinguished from those owned by persons with a purely theoretical interest in medicine. This is not just a function of our ignorance about the owners of these books – although it is true that we may not know enough to characterise them – but reflects the difficulty of drawing hard and fast lines between theory and practice of medicine. Almost all of the men who can be identified as possessing medical degrees from Oxford, Cambridge and the Scottish or other European universities are known to have practised as well as taught medicine. Conversely, those book-owners we can identify as surgeons or unlicensed medical practitioners did not keep in their libraries books which were of a kind noticeably different from those owned by the university trained men. Both licensed and unlicensed practitioners might own recipe-books, or herbals, or texts on surgery and the medical practica. So too with institutions, monastic houses, colleges or gilds of practitioners – they often seem to have owned medical books that reflected both the curriculum of the university medical school and the exigencies of medical treatment of patients." @default.
